The Importance of Choosing an Experienced Kitchen Countertop Installer in Geneva’s Homes

Choosing an experienced kitchen countertop installer is essential for homeowners in Geneva looking to upgrade their kitchens with precision and lasting quality.

A skilled installer understands the nuances of different countertop materials—like granite, quartz, or butcher block—and ensures proper measurement, cutting, and secure installation to avoid costly mistakes or future repairs.

Their experience also allows for efficient handling of challenges such as uneven walls, plumbing cutouts, or custom designs.

Navigating the Limited Selection of High-Quality Materials for Kitchen Countertops in Geneva

Due to its small size and nature, Geneva may have a limited selection of high-quality countertop materials readily available.

However, a skilled kitchen countertop installer will know how to source the best options for your project, even if it means looking beyond local suppliers.

When discussing material options with your installer, consider factors like durability, maintenance requirements, and aesthetic appeal.

Some materials, like natural stone or engineered quartz, offer timeless beauty and long-lasting performance.

Others, like butcher block or concrete, can add unique character to your home.

Material Durability Maintenance
Granite High Seal annually
Quartz Very High Minimal
Butcher Block Moderate Oil regularly

How to Avoid the Delays of Peak Renovation Seasons in Geneva

Like many small towns, Geneva experiences a surge in renovation projects during the summer months.

This increased demand can lead to longer wait times for materials and installation services.

To avoid delays, it’s best to plan your kitchen countertop installation well in advance.

Work with your installer to create a timeline that accounts for potential supply chain issues and busy contractor schedules.

If possible, consider starting your project during the off-season when demand is lower.

Your installer may also have suggestions for alternative materials that are more readily available, reducing the risk of delays.

  • Begin planning your renovation 6-12 months in advance
  • Order materials early to avoid supply chain delays
  • Be flexible with your installation date to accommodate contractor availability
  • Have a contingency plan in case of unexpected setbacks
